USN7-1 : imagemagick vulnerability Vulnerability Scan
Vulnerability Scan Summary imagemagick vulnerability
Detailed Explanation for this Vulnerability Test
Synopsis :
These remote packages are missing security patches :
- imagemagick
- libmagick++6
- libmagick++6-dev
- libmagick6
- libmagick6-dev
- perlmagick
Description :
A buffer overflow in imagemagick's EXIF parsing routine has been
discovered in imagemagick versions prior to 6.1.0. Trying to query
EXIF information of a malicious image file might result in execution
of arbitrary code with the user's rights.
Since imagemagick can be used in custom printing systems, this also
might lead to privilege escalation (execute code with the printer
spooler's rights). However, Ubuntu's standard printing system does
not use imagemagick, thus there is no risk of privilege escalation in
a standard installation.
Solution :
Upgrade to :
- imagemagick-6.0.2.5-1ubuntu1.1 (Ubuntu 4.10)
- libmagick++6-6.0.2.5-1ubuntu1.1 (Ubuntu 4.10)
- libmagick++6-dev-6.0.2.5-1ubuntu1.1 (Ubuntu 4.10)
- libmagick6-6.0.2.5-1ubuntu1.1 (Ubuntu 4.10)
- libmagick6-dev-6.0.2.5-1ubuntu1.1 (Ubuntu 4.10)
- perlmagick-6.0.2.5-1ubuntu1.1 (Ubuntu 4.10)
Threat Level: High
